Game 25 vs Richmond hill Stars away 18 Jan 2014
A 5-0 WIN
A regular season series sweep of the Richmond Hill Stars (3-0)!!!

Some comments and observations:
A total team effort from the goaltending right on out to the forwards.  Team defence lead the way today along with some relentless backchecking to solidify this win and the shutout.  The kids protected our goaltender and cleared out the front of the net and would not be pushed around.  It's great to see that they are all getting it now and are learning how important it is. 
We opened the scoring in this game and then finished it off with Richmond Hill pushing hard in between to try and get on the board.  Our goal scoring came from everywhere including our defencemen which also contributed to this overall team effort.
